Every time a golfer enters a pro shop it’s like a kid entering a candy store. Every shelf and rack lined with goodies it’s hard to choose what to buy. NBA Star J.R. Smith didn’t have this issue, he just bought pretty much everything!

 The former NBA sixth man of the year recently played Pine Valley with former NFL wide receiver, his brother, and fellow NBA player Chris Smith.  This was the first time Smith played Pine Valley and he clearly wanted to remember it. When I play a new course, I buy a ball or a yardage book. Smith bought the pro shop. He even ended his Instagram post with #ProShopWillNeverBeTheSame.

Smith played only 11 games last season while his team worked on finding him a new home. He still made about $15 million so it’s not like he didn’t have cash to spend. If this is what Smith does when he plays a new course, I can only imagine what will come later this season. When the golf bug bites, it bites hard. With the amount of time and money Smith has right now, the only question for Smith is what course pro shop will he buy out next?
